The Reactive-Tool Trap
When a security gap surfaces, a break-in, a near-miss, a state audit finding, the fastest thing an administrator can do is buy something. A camera. A card reader. A monitoring contract. It feels like progress, and it is easy to defend in a budget meeting.
The problem is what happens next. Each purchase gets made in isolation, so each one becomes its own island: separate licensing, separate support contract, separate login for a different team. That is how campuses end up drowning in cameras while starving for insight. Nobody set out to build a fragmented system. It accreted, one reasonable purchase at a time. And every one of those standalone systems is really just a record of what the campus failed to prevent.
Calling that collection of tools a strategy does not make it one. Cameras don't make a campus safe. Programs do.
What a security incident actually costs
Here is the math that reframes the whole conversation: the fallout from a single security failure is almost always larger than the cost of preventing it.
Take a data breach where an attacker compromises a campus server. That one event can force a university to notify tens of thousands of students, staff, and alumni, absorb months of IT time, invite regulatory scrutiny, and do reputational damage that outlasts the technical fix by years. Disjointed systems quietly raise that risk, because every extra platform is one more attack surface, one more renewal to track, one more thing that can fail unnoticed.
Prevention rarely shows up as a line item, which is exactly why it gets undervalued. The incident that never happens never generates a cost. But it is almost always the cheapest option on the table. Proactive investment can also pay back directly. When the University of Illinois Chicago piloted AI-powered monitoring across 30 outdoor cameras, the school cut third-party security costs by roughly 50%, about $236,000 a year for every 24/7 position it no longer needed to staff. What a real campus safety program looks like
A real campus safety program is welcoming by design, not a fortress. It rests on three things working together, none of which you can buy off a shelf.
A culture of safety, not surveillance. The best sensor on any campus is a person who knows what to report and trusts that reporting it will matter. That culture erodes the moment people feel watched rather than protected, which is why the surveillance question is not an ethics footnote, it is an adoption problem. Treat Clery Act and Title IX reporting as more than annual paperwork, too. The patterns inside those reports are early warnings, if anyone is reading them as such.
Cross-functional coalitions. No single office owns safety. It takes an active partnership between Public Safety, Student Affairs, Facilities and Operations, IT, and Executive Leadership, each with a real stake in the outcome rather than just a seat at the table. Technology does not replace that coalition. It gives the coalition better information to act on. As Noah Skinner, Director of Safety and Emergency Management at UC Law San Francisco, puts it:
"Even with the best security staff, human limitations exist... [good technology] ensures that critical activity is detected and immediately brought to our attention."
That is the force-multiplier idea in one sentence. The people stay in charge. The system makes sure nothing critical slips past a tired eye at 3 a.m.
An aligned, strategic roadmap. Instead of buying point solutions as gaps appear, proactive campuses start by mapping their current state, defining clear functional requirements, and tying the safety plan to institutional goals, including the goal of staying open and welcoming rather than locked down. The Proactive Campus Safety Stack
Shifting the moment of intervention earlier means moving up a stack, not just buying up a shopping list. Nine layers, building on each other:

- Layer 0 — Mindset Shift: moving the entire campus culture from reactive response to proactive prevention.
- Layer 1 — Designed Environment (CPTED): using lighting, sightlines, landscaping, and territoriality so the physical campus itself deters incidents.
- Layer 2 — Intelligent Visibility: layering smart video analytics — including a human-verified Virtual Security Operations Center — onto the cameras you already own, instead of a costly rip-and-replace project.
- Layer 3 — Controlled Access: layered, zoned credentialing that balances open, welcoming spaces with real security in critical areas.
- Layer 4 — Early Awareness: threat assessment and care teams that route concerns to help before they become incidents.
- Layer 5 — Compliance & Transparency: turning Clery and Title IX reporting into a proactive engine that surfaces patterns of risk.
- Layer 6 — Coordinated Response: moving emergency preparedness out of a binder and into live, cross-department tabletop drills.
- Layer 7 — Sustained Coalition: building a board-ready ROI case that secures long-term funding and shared executive ownership.
- Layer 8 — Measurement: defining leading and lagging indicators that prove prevention is actually working, so the program keeps improving.

What is CPTED, and why does it matter for a college campus?
CPTED, or Crime Prevention Through Environmental Design, uses lighting, sightlines, landscaping, and clear territoriality to make a physical space naturally discourage incidents. On a campus it means designing security into renovation and construction plans from the start, rather than retrofitting it after something goes wrong. It sits at Layer 1 of the stack because the cheapest incident to manage is the one the environment quietly prevents.
Who actually needs to be involved in a cross-functional safety coalition?
At minimum: Public Safety, Student Affairs, Facilities and Operations, IT, and Executive Leadership. Leave one of those groups out and the program tends to develop a blind spot exactly where that group's expertise was needed. The coalition is also what keeps a safety program funded across budget cycles, because shared ownership is much harder to cut than a line item owned by a single department.
